Longitudinal waves in an elastic rod caused by sudden damage to the foundation [PDF]

open access: yesTheoretical and Applied Mechanics, 2021
We study the problem of propagating longitudinal waves in an elastic rod connected to a locally damaged foundation through a thin elastic layer. The motion of the rigid foundation blocks is considered predetermined.

Influence of Geometry on Thin Layer and Diffusion Processes at Carbon Electrodes.

open access: yesLangmuir, 2021
The geometric structure of carbon electrodes affects their electrochemical behavior, and large-scale surface roughness leads to thin layer electrochemistry when analyte is trapped in pores.

Digital Light Processing of 2D Lattice Composites for Tunable Self‐Sensing and Mechanical Performance

open access: yesAdvanced Engineering Materials, EarlyView., 2023
The study presents the mechanical and in situ sensing performance of digital light processing‐enabled 2D lattice nanocomposites under monotonic tensile and repeated cyclic loading, and provides guidelines for the design of architectures suitable for strain sensors and smart lightweight structures.
